International Plastics News for Asia Description:

International Plastics News for Asia is published 6x a year in English with highlights in Chinese. The magazine is uniquely positioned to serve the needs of South East Asia's plastics processing industry, including contract molders and manufacturers with in-plant machinery lines. It provides the latest market information, quality technical features, trade show reviews and videos, and people and company profiles written by industry experts and correspondents across the region. Also included are exclusive content and articles from Ringier's family of plastics industry magazines covering Greater China region, the Middle East and other parts of the world, such as Modern Plastics and Polymers in India, Plastics Engineering in the US, Kunststoffe in Germany, Polymer Materials in Russia, Technologia del Plastico in Latin Amercia – which are the leading magazines in their respective markets. The interactive content allows readers to make direct and immediate contact with advertisers/suppliers and featured companies in the editorial by clicking on the web site and email addresses in each issue, access online content in Ringier’s plastics website in English and Chinese (plastics.industrysourcing.com), and avail of video content through iTunes and Google Play.

In this issue

Every last issue of the year, we provide our readers with the Outlook Report, a special article where we gather the insights of industry experts on the trends and developments in the plastics and rubber industry in the Asia Pacific region. In this issue’s Outlook 2015, we selected and invited companies that have made their mark in the industry through their innovative products and how these products would respond to the specific market demands in the coming year and beyond. I always look forward to getting the responses because they make some very interesting assessment of the industry, on emerging applications and overall global trends. The TaipeiPLAS 2014 post-show review is also included in this issue. Technology-driven, the show is always a well-attended event and reflects the growing strength of Taiwan’s plastics machinery industry. The latest high performance materials are finding their way in the sporting goods sector as material researchers and sports shoe developers work closely together to transform latest scientific findings into products that can aid athletes in moving beyond established records.
